Patrick McCue

[3] A forward with the Newtown Rugby Union club in Sydney, McCue was selected on the first Wallaby tour of England in 1908–1909, the squad captained by Herbert Moran.

That side competed in the 1908 Summer Olympics in London, and McCue was a member of the Australia national rugby union team captained by Chris McKivat, which won the gold medal.

[4] Along with fourteen of his Olympic Wallaby teammates, on his return to Australia, he negotiated to take part in promotional matches against the Pioneer Kangaroos.

He helped the club win premiership honours that year, playing at second-row forward in the 1910 NSWRFL season's final.

In 2008, the centenary year of rugby league in Australia, McCue was named in the Newtown Jets 18-man team of the century.
